The production company based in Los Angeles, Central Films North, recently produced the new commercials for the Mexican bookstores Gandhi. The awarded director, Rodrigo García Saiz, was in charge of the complex shooting in which hundreds of youngsters faced the police to challenge them with knowledge.Young & Rubicam México developed the concept of the piece titled Weapons, which poses that knowledge is the most powerful tool. In the commercial, there is a group of protesters who are violently repressed by the police, and the youngsters only defend themselves using books as weapons.García Saiz has won international awards for his films for Gandhi. In 2012 he won a bronze Lion in Cannes for the bookstore´s Woods commercial.The creative team responsible for Weapons is formed by: Jose Montalvo, CCO of the agency; Agustin Vélez, General Creative Director; Sergio Díaz Infante, Creative Director; Rodrigo Ramírez, copywriter; Francisco Hernández, Art Director; Bernardo Salum, Head of Production and Noel Abreu, Producer at the agency. From Central Films North: Rodrigo García Saiz, Director; Beto Casillas, Photography Director; Mauricio Francini, Executive Producer; Jorge Hernández, Editor; Ricky Gaussis, colorist and Leonel Pérez, Post producer. Sonideros was in charge of the music.
